The Laramie, Wyoming City Council held a regular meeting on May 6, 2026, which included several procurement and budget-related discussions. Key procurement actions included approval of multiple construction and infrastructure projects, such as the Ivansson infrastructure upgrades phase 2 and the 15th Street reconstruction project, with contracts awarded to Tri Hydro Corporation for construction management and contract administration services totaling over $1.2 million. The council also approved amendments to the fiscal year 2026 budget, including a $244,350 increase for various facility repairs and operational costs. Additionally, the council approved community partner funding allocations totaling $231,267 for the 2026-2027 fiscal year. A significant agenda item was the approval of a resolution recommending the Westside urban renewal plan and project, which sets the framework for potential tax increment financing (TIF) to support public improvements such as stormwater management and infrastructure upgrades on a large vacant property. Public comments raised concerns about floodplain development and the impact of TIF on affordable housing. The council also adopted policy goals and objectives for fiscal year 2027, emphasizing financial sustainability, infrastructure, and economic development. Motions related to procurement and budget passed unanimously.
